The pricing range for the most recent Mercedes Benz C Class is between 58.65 Lakhs and 64.30 Lakhs. There are 4 different variants of the Mercedes Benz C Class. The base model, the "Mercedes Benz C Class C 220d", is offered at 58.65 Lakhs, while the top model, the "Mercedes Benz C Class C 300" costs around 64.30 Lakhs. However, on-road costs vary from city to city.
Depending on the engine selected, the C Class mileage is between 16.9 to 23 kmpl. The Mercedes Benz C Class delivers several amenities and Mercedes Benz's quality assurance while displaying various advancements over its previous generation.

Car Retail Sales August 2025: Maruti and Mahindra Lead
Passenger vehicle sales in India edged up modestly in August 2025 despite cautious buying ahead of GST 2.0 implementation. Maruti Suzuki, Mahindra, Toyota, Skoda, and MG reported growth, while Hyundai, Tata, Honda, Renault, and Nissan registered declines. Luxury brands showed mixed results, with BMW gaining and Mercedes-Benz slipping.

2025 Maruti XL6 reaches showrooms, with updated features
Maruti Suzuki has quietly rolled out the updated 2025 XL6 to its Nexa showrooms across India. The premium MPV now comes with a slightly longer body, a revised interior setup, better convenience for rear passengers, and 6 airbags as standard. Despite these changes, prices remain unaffected, making the XL6 an even stronger contender in its segment.

Tata Cars Prices Slashed by Up to Rs. 1.55 Lakh in India
Tata Motors has rolled out significant price cuts across its passenger vehicle portfolio in India following the GST 2.0 reforms. The revised prices, effective immediately, cover popular models including the Tiago, Tigor, Altroz, Punch, Nexon, Curvv, Harrier, and Safari, making Tata’s cars more accessible and competitive across multiple segments.

Kia India Prices Cut by Up to Rs. 4.49 Lakh from Sept 22
Kia India has announced significant price cuts across its model range following the revised GST norms. Effective from September 22, the revisions will bring down prices of popular models, including the Carnival, Syros, Sonet, Seltos, Carens, and Clariss, offering customers substantial savings and making Kia’s portfolio more competitive in the Indian market.

Mercedes GLC EV Unveiled with 713km Range and 39-Inch Display
Mercedes-Benz has taken the wraps off its all-new electric GLC SUV at the Munich IAA Mobility 2025 and built on the dedicated MB.EA EV platform, the luxury SUV features futuristic design elements, a 942-pixel illuminated grille, rapid 800V charging, and the brand’s largest-ever 39-inch Hyperscreen, promising performance and luxury in equal measure.
